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and prolonged downtime. Don't let your bathroom become a disaster zone. Keep an eye out for: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Unpleasant smells can show a hidden issue, such as mold growth or standing water. If you notice persistent odors in your bathroom, it's time to call our team for a thorough inspection and restoration.

Warped Flooring or Cabinets

Water damage can cause warping, buckling, or discoloration of your bathroom's flooring and cabinets. Catching this issue early on can prevent costly replacements and extend the lifespan of your fixtures.

Water Stains or Mineral Deposits

Visible water stains or mineral deposits on your bathroom's surfaces can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team will work tirelessly to remove these stains and restore your bathroom to its original condition.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, bubble, or discolor. Ignoring this issue can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Let our team help you address this problem before it's too late.

Discolored or Faded Grout

Discolored or faded grout can be a sign of water damage or neglect. Our team will work to restore your grout to its original condition,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for your family.

Water-Saturated Insulation or Drywall

Hidden water damage can lead to mold growth, structural issues, or even collapse. Our team will inspect and address any hidden damage to ensure your bathroom is safe and secure.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ost in Clinton, OH

The cost of bathroom water removal var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Clinton, OH.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should serve as a general guideline for homeowners facing bathroom water dam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Cleaning $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ring and fixtures, and extent of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$300 - $1,200 Duration of drying process, number of dehumidifiers required, and type of insulation or drywall affected
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 - $800 Size of affected area, type of sanitizing agents used, and extent of mold growth or bacterial contamination
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 - $500 Number of touch-ups required, complexity of repairs, and extent of restoration needed
Emergency Response and Assessment $0 - $200 Distance from our response team, time of day, and complexity of initial assessment

Q: What's the best way to prevent water damage in my bathroom?

A: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ent water damage in your bathroom. Check your bathroom's plumbing, fixtures, and appliances regularly for signs of wear and tear. Also, ensure that your bathroom is properly ventilated to prevent moisture buildup.
